{{Articles Needing DB Links}} {{Infobox Job |jobName=Archer |jobType=First |changesAt=[[Payon]] |skills=5 |skillPoints=50 |questSkills=2 |str=3|agi=3|vit=1|int=2|dex=7|luk=2}} == Overview == Archers are experts at long-range combat with [[Bows]] and [[Arrows]]. Their range gives them several advantages, which includes: *The ability to change the element of their weapon quickly by changing their arrow type. This makes Archers able to exploit elemental advantages easily. *Accuracy and damage is increased by the same stat (DEX), allowing all attacks to connect and deal a lot of damage. *Range enables archers to defeat stationary or slow-moving opponents that are stronger than they are without being hit. Drawbacks of the Archer class include: *Low VIT limits their ability to survive when they are caught up in melee situations. *Require Arrows for every attack with a Bow. '''Starting Build''' *'''STR:''' 1 *'''AGI:''' 9 *'''VIT:''' 1 *'''INT:''' 9 *'''DEX:''' 9 *'''LUK:''' 1 === Stats === *[[STR]]: The only normal reason to up STR on an Archer is to extend the [[Weight Limit]], allowing for more Potions and [[Arrows]] to be carried. Archers should leave this at 1, but they may find it useful/other uses for it once they become a second class. The other reason to get STR is for a [[Beast Strafing]] build which requires to be Soul Linked. *[[AGI]]: Archers aspiring to be PvM Bards or Dancers, or who will become Hunters will find AGI to nearly as/more important than DEX. AGI increases [[ASPD]], allowing the Archer to attack more often (and before the enemy can close into melee range) and deal more damage over-time. It also enables Archers to [[Flee]] an adversary and more easily evade their attacks. *[[VIT]] is reasonable for players who wish to PvP or take part in the War of Emperium. Pure PvM builds do not often invest in VIT. *[[INT]] is also intended for Archers, usually only those who will become Bards or Dancers, rushing for level 99 to rebirth as it allows constant Double Strafe spamming. INT is used for the Bard skill [[Magic Strings]] for reducing skill delay. INT contributes to Falcon damage (for hunters). *[[DEX]]: Begin with these stats on a Novice for most types of Archers. As an Archer, the most important stat will be DEX. It increases ASPD a little, reduces cast time, increases accuracy, and it improves bow damage greatly. *[[LUK]] is useful if the Archer intends to change into a Hunter. LUK increases Falcon attack rate. INT also contributes to Falcon damage by increasing its ATK, but Falconers should prioritized it after AGI and LUK, not substituting any of these stats for INT. You can add 1 point to arrow shower in 2nd Job if u want to max it. ==Equipment== ===From Scratch=== If as a Novice you begun with a lot of DEX, switch to a bow as soon as possible. Initially the startup fee will be high because you will have to buy arrows, but this fee decreases overtime. Any kind of upgrade that increases ATK or DEX is good for an archer. ===With Budget=== Wise Goggles or any Wise headgear. The +80 SP helps with Double Strafe. At level 18 Archers are able to wield Cross Bows. These should be carded and upgraded. Carded Composite Bows [4] will not deal as much damage at this point as Cross Bows, but they will be more useful later on if the player will eventually have 130+ DEX. Gakkung Bows are also effective for low DEX Archers or if no cards are being used. ==Class Data== ===Skills=== ''For second class skills see [[Hunter#Skills|Hunter Skills]], [[Dancer#Skills|Dancer Skills]], or [[Bard#Skills|Bard Skills]].'' {| class="wikitablec sortable" |- !
